112 /* asmlinkage void aesni_gcm_enc()
113  * void *ctx,  AES Key schedule. Starts on a 16 byte boundary.
114  * struct gcm_context_data.  May be uninitialized.
115  * u8 *out, Ciphertext output. Encrypt in-place is allowed.
116  * const u8 *in, Plaintext input
117  * unsigned long plaintext_len, Length of data in bytes for encryption.
118  * u8 *iv, Pre-counter block j0: 12 byte IV concatenated with 0x00000001.
119  *         16-byte aligned pointer.
120  * u8 *hash_subkey, the Hash sub key input. Data starts on a 16-byte boundary.
121  * const u8 *aad, Additional Authentication Data (AAD)
122  * unsigned long aad_len, Length of AAD in bytes.
123  * u8 *auth_tag, Authenticated Tag output.
124  * unsigned long auth_tag_len), Authenticated Tag Length in bytes.
125  *          Valid values are 16 (most likely), 12 or 8.
126  */
127 asmlinkage void aesni_gcm_enc(void *ctx,
128 			struct gcm_context_data *gdata, u8 *out,
129 			const u8 *in, unsigned long plaintext_len, u8 *iv,
130 			u8 *hash_subkey, const u8 *aad, unsigned long aad_len,
131 			u8 *auth_tag, unsigned long auth_tag_len);
132 
133 /* asmlinkage void aesni_gcm_dec()
134  * void *ctx, AES Key schedule. Starts on a 16 byte boundary.
135  * struct gcm_context_data.  May be uninitialized.
136  * u8 *out, Plaintext output. Decrypt in-place is allowed.
137  * const u8 *in, Ciphertext input
138  * unsigned long ciphertext_len, Length of data in bytes for decryption.
139  * u8 *iv, Pre-counter block j0: 12 byte IV concatenated with 0x00000001.
140  *         16-byte aligned pointer.
141  * u8 *hash_subkey, the Hash sub key input. Data starts on a 16-byte boundary.
142  * const u8 *aad, Additional Authentication Data (AAD)
143  * unsigned long aad_len, Length of AAD in bytes. With RFC4106 this is going
144  * to be 8 or 12 bytes
145  * u8 *auth_tag, Authenticated Tag output.
146  * unsigned long auth_tag_len) Authenticated Tag Length in bytes.
147  * Valid values are 16 (most likely), 12 or 8.
148  */
149 asmlinkage void aesni_gcm_dec(void *ctx,
150 			struct gcm_context_data *gdata, u8 *out,
151 			const u8 *in, unsigned long ciphertext_len, u8 *iv,
152 			u8 *hash_subkey, const u8 *aad, unsigned long aad_len,
153 			u8 *auth_tag, unsigned long auth_tag_len);

703 static int gcmaes_crypt_by_sg(bool enc, struct aead_request *req,
704 			      unsigned int assoclen, u8 *hash_subkey,
705 			      u8 *iv, void *aes_ctx)
706 {
707 	struct crypto_aead *tfm = crypto_aead_reqtfm(req);
708 	unsigned long auth_tag_len = crypto_aead_authsize(tfm);
709 	const struct aesni_gcm_tfm_s *gcm_tfm = aesni_gcm_tfm;
710 	struct gcm_context_data data AESNI_ALIGN_ATTR;
711 	struct scatter_walk dst_sg_walk = {};
712 	unsigned long left = req->cryptlen;
713 	unsigned long len, srclen, dstlen;
714 	struct scatter_walk assoc_sg_walk;
715 	struct scatter_walk src_sg_walk;
716 	struct scatterlist src_start[2];
717 	struct scatterlist dst_start[2];
718 	struct scatterlist *src_sg;
719 	struct scatterlist *dst_sg;
720 	u8 *src, *dst, *assoc;
721 	u8 *assocmem = NULL;
722 	u8 authTag[16];
723 
724 	if (!enc)
725 		left -= auth_tag_len;
726 
727 #ifdef CONFIG_AS_AVX2
728 	if (left < AVX_GEN4_OPTSIZE && gcm_tfm == &aesni_gcm_tfm_avx_gen4)
729 		gcm_tfm = &aesni_gcm_tfm_avx_gen2;
730 #endif
731 #ifdef CONFIG_AS_AVX
732 	if (left < AVX_GEN2_OPTSIZE && gcm_tfm == &aesni_gcm_tfm_avx_gen2)
733 		gcm_tfm = &aesni_gcm_tfm_sse;
734 #endif
735 
736 	/* Linearize assoc, if not already linear */
737 	if (req->src->length >= assoclen && req->src->length &&
738 		(!PageHighMem(sg_page(req->src)) ||
739 			req->src->offset + req->src->length <= PAGE_SIZE)) {
740 		scatterwalk_start(&assoc_sg_walk, req->src);
741 		assoc = scatterwalk_map(&assoc_sg_walk);
742 	} else {
743 		/* assoc can be any length, so must be on heap */
744 		assocmem = kmalloc(assoclen, GFP_ATOMIC);
745 		if (unlikely(!assocmem))
746 			return -ENOMEM;
747 		assoc = assocmem;
748 
749 		scatterwalk_map_and_copy(assoc, req->src, 0, assoclen, 0);
750 	}
751 
752 	if (left) {
753 		src_sg = scatterwalk_ffwd(src_start, req->src, req->assoclen);
754 		scatterwalk_start(&src_sg_walk, src_sg);
755 		if (req->src != req->dst) {
756 			dst_sg = scatterwalk_ffwd(dst_start, req->dst,
757 						  req->assoclen);
758 			scatterwalk_start(&dst_sg_walk, dst_sg);
759 		}
760 	}
761 
762 	kernel_fpu_begin();
763 	gcm_tfm->init(aes_ctx, &data, iv,
764 		hash_subkey, assoc, assoclen);
765 	if (req->src != req->dst) {
766 		while (left) {
767 			src = scatterwalk_map(&src_sg_walk);
768 			dst = scatterwalk_map(&dst_sg_walk);
769 			srclen = scatterwalk_clamp(&src_sg_walk, left);
770 			dstlen = scatterwalk_clamp(&dst_sg_walk, left);
771 			len = min(srclen, dstlen);
772 			if (len) {
773 				if (enc)
774 					gcm_tfm->enc_update(aes_ctx, &data,
775 							     dst, src, len);
776 				else
777 					gcm_tfm->dec_update(aes_ctx, &data,
778 							     dst, src, len);
779 			}
780 			left -= len;
781 
782 			scatterwalk_unmap(src);
783 			scatterwalk_unmap(dst);
784 			scatterwalk_advance(&src_sg_walk, len);
785 			scatterwalk_advance(&dst_sg_walk, len);
786 			scatterwalk_done(&src_sg_walk, 0, left);
787 			scatterwalk_done(&dst_sg_walk, 1, left);
788 		}
789 	} else {
790 		while (left) {
791 			dst = src = scatterwalk_map(&src_sg_walk);
792 			len = scatterwalk_clamp(&src_sg_walk, left);
793 			if (len) {
794 				if (enc)
795 					gcm_tfm->enc_update(aes_ctx, &data,
796 							     src, src, len);
797 				else
798 					gcm_tfm->dec_update(aes_ctx, &data,
799 							     src, src, len);
800 			}
801 			left -= len;
802 			scatterwalk_unmap(src);
803 			scatterwalk_advance(&src_sg_walk, len);
804 			scatterwalk_done(&src_sg_walk, 1, left);
805 		}
806 	}
807 	gcm_tfm->finalize(aes_ctx, &data, authTag, auth_tag_len);
808 	kernel_fpu_end();
809 
810 	if (!assocmem)
811 		scatterwalk_unmap(assoc);
812 	else
813 		kfree(assocmem);
814 
815 	if (!enc) {
816 		u8 authTagMsg[16];
817 
818 		/* Copy out original authTag */
819 		scatterwalk_map_and_copy(authTagMsg, req->src,
820 					 req->assoclen + req->cryptlen -
821 					 auth_tag_len,
822 					 auth_tag_len, 0);
823 
824 		/* Compare generated tag with passed in tag. */
825 		return crypto_memneq(authTagMsg, authTag, auth_tag_len) ?
826 			-EBADMSG : 0;
827 	}
828 
829 	/* Copy in the authTag */
830 	scatterwalk_map_and_copy(authTag, req->dst,
831 				 req->assoclen + req->cryptlen,
832 				 auth_tag_len, 1);
833 
834 	return 0;
835 }
